Apologies for the late response. The message you saw before installing a plugin referred to the underlying WordPress.com address. Because of technical reasons, your site’s free WordPress.com address changes when you install a plugin, upload a theme or activate hosting features.
However, as long as you have a custom domain on your site, that underlying WordPress.com address is not visible to your visitors. So it shouldn’t be of concern.
This means you can still use the domain ynbound.ch with your WordPress.com site. You do need to point it to WordPress.com name servers or IP addresses. Please follow the steps here to do that: https://wordpress.com/support/domains/connect-existing-domain/#step-2-change-your-domains-name-servers
Within 72 hours of updating the name servers or adding our IP addresses to the domain, your WordPress.com site will start loading at your domain. At that point, you can make your domain primary by following this guide:
Your primary site address is the domain that people will see in their browser’s address bar when they visit your site. It is the address you use to promote your website. With a WordPress.com plan, you can set a custom domain as the primary site address.
